Arriva Cymru Limited is seeking a skilled PSV/HGV Engineer with demonstrable electrical experience to maintain and repair our fleet of buses and heavy goods vehicles, ensuring safety, reliability, and operational efficiency.

Responsibilities

  • Perform routine inspections, maintenance, and repairs on PSV and HGV fleets, including engines, transmissions, braking systems, and steering mechanisms.
  • Diagnose and rectify complex electrical faults and system malfunctions using diagnostic equipment and schematics.
  • Conduct preventative maintenance checks and adhere to scheduled service intervals to minimise breakdowns and maximise vehicle uptime.
  • Carry out vehicle modifications and component replacements in accordance with manufacturer guidelines and company procedures.
  • Complete all necessary documentation accurately and on time, including job cards, defect reports, and service sheets.
  • Ensure compliance with all health and safety regulations, company policies, and VOSA standards.
  • Participate in on-call rotation or overtime as required to support operational needs.
  • Maintain a clean and organised workshop environment.
  • Collaborate effectively with colleagues and management to resolve technical issues and improve workshop efficiency.

Qualifications

  • NVQ Level 3 or equivalent in Heavy Vehicle Maintenance and Repair, or a relevant engineering discipline.
  • Proven experience as a PSV or HGV Engineer in a workshop environment.
  • Demonstrable expertise in diagnosing and rectifying complex electrical systems and faults on modern commercial vehicles.
  • Full UK driving licence, preferably with PCV and/or HGV entitlements.
  • Proficiency in using diagnostic tools and equipment specific to PSVs and HGVs.
  • Strong understanding of vehicle safety regulations and VOSA requirements.
  • Ability to read and interpret technical manuals, wiring diagrams, and schematics.
  • Excellent problem-solving skills and attention to detail.
  • Good commun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
